Rockwell R65C24J
тел. +7(499)347-04-82
Описание Rockwell R65C24J
Отличный выбор! Rockwell R65C24J — это классический 8-битный микропроцессор, являющийся усовершенствованной версией легендарного MOS Technology 6502.
Общее описание
R65C24J — это высокопроизводительный, низкопотребляющий CMOS-микропроцессор, разработанный Rockwell Semiconductor. Он представляет собой усовершенствованную реализацию архитектуры 6502, сохраняя полную объектную и функциональную совместимость с оригинальным NMOS 6502, но с рядом ключевых улучшений.
Основные отличия от оригинального NMOS 6502:
- Техпроцесс CMOS: Значительно меньшее энергопотребление и более высокая устойчивость к помехам.
- Расширенный набор инструкций: Добавлены новые команды, включая операции с битами, блочный перенос, дополнительные режимы адресации (например, 16-битный непосредственный операнд) и команды для управления энергопотреблением (STP, WIT).
- Увеличенная тактовая частота: Работает на более высоких частотах по сравнению с NMOS-версиями.
- Внутренние улучшения: Устранены многие "недокументированные" инструкции и нестабильности оригинального 6502, работа с прерываниями стала более предсказуемой.
- Статическое ядро: Может работать на сколь угодно низкой частоте вплоть до 0 Гц (постоянного тока), что критично для применений с батарейным питанием и режимами энергосбережения.
Основные области применения: Встраиваемые системы, промышленная автоматизация, медицинское оборудование, контроллеры периферии, системы с батарейным питанием, а также в качестве замены 6502 в старых компьютерах и игровых приставках для модернизации.
Технические характеристики (ТТХ)
| Параметр | Характеристика | | :--- | :--- | | Архитектура | 8-битный микропроцессор | | Набор инструкций | 6502 (полная совместимость) + расширенный набор R65C02 (более 60 инструкций) | | Техпроцесс | CMOS | | Тактовая частота (max) | 3 МГц для версии R65C24J (существовали и другие версии на 2 МГц и 4 МГц) | | Напряжение питания | +5 В ±5% | | Потребляемый ток | ~ 3-10 мА (тип., на 1 МГц), значительно меньше NMOS 6502 | | Температурный диапазон | J-версия: 0°C до +70°C (коммерческий). Существовала S-версия (военный/расширенный диапазон). | | Корпус | DIP-24 (Dual In-line Package, 24 вывода). J в названии часто указывает на корпус типа DIP. | | Адресное пространство | 64 КБ | | Регистры | Аккумулятор (A), индексные регистры X и Y, регистр состояния (P), счетчик команд (PC), указатель стека (S). | | Прерывания | IRQ (маскируемое), NMI (немаскируемое), RESET. | | Особенности | Статическое ядро, инструкции STOP (STP) и WAIT (WIT) для управления питанием, аппаратный умножитель/делитель (в некоторых поздних версиях, но не в базовой R65C24J). |
Парт-номера и совместимые модели
Микропроцессор выпускался под разными парт-номерами в зависимости от производителя, скорости и температурного диапазона.
Прямые аналоги и парт-номера Rockwell/WDC:
- R65C02 — общее обозначение семейства.
- R65C24J — конкретная версия на 3 МГц в корпусе DIP-24, коммерческий температурный диапазон.
- R65C24S — версия с расширенным температурным диапазоном.
- R65C104J / R65C104S — аналог от Western Design Center (WDC), который лицензировал и развивал дизайн. WDC до сих пор производит эти процессоры (под маркой W65C02S).
- W65C02S — современный прямой аналог от WDC, доступный для покупки. Полностью совместим по выводам и функциональности.
Совместимые модели (можно использовать как замену):
Важно: Замена обычно возможна "как есть" (drop-in), но нужно учитывать максимальную тактовую частоту и возможные тонкие различия в таймингах.
-
Прямые CMOS-совместимые аналоги:
- Rockwell: R65C00, R65C10, R65C12, R65C21 (все — вариации с разной скоростью и корпусами).
- Western Design Center (WDC): W65C02, W65C102, W65C112, W65C802 (вариации с разной периферией).
- GTE (G65SC02, G65SC102): Еще один лицензированный производитель.
- Synertek: SY65C02 (встречается реже).
- NCR: 65C02 (производился по лицензии).
-
Оригинальные NMOS-процессоры (замена возможна, но с оговорками):
- MOS Technology: 6502, 6502A, 6502B, 6512 (требует внешнего тактового генератора).
- Synertek: SY6502, SY6502A.
- Rockwell: R6502, R6502Q, R6502AP.
- **Важно для NMOS: При замене NMOS 6502 на R65C24J система, как правило, заработает. Но обратная замена (CMOS на место NMOS) может не сработать из-за разных электрических характеристик и таймингов. Также R65C02 не имеет "недокументированных" команд, на которые некоторые старые программы могли неявно опираться.
Где использовался R65C24J и его аналоги:
- Компьютеры: Apple IIc, Apple IIGS (в качестве вспомогательного процессора), BBC Master, Commodore 65 (прототип), различные домашние компьютеры 80-х.
- Игровые приставки: Atari 7800 (в качестве основного CPU), модификации для NES/Famicom (замена оригинального Ricoh 2A03, который является 6502-ядром).
- Промышленность и встраиваемые системы: Бесчисленное количество контроллеров, измерительных приборов, медицинской аппаратуры (например, ранние модели глюкометров, инфузионные pumps).
Вывод: R65C24J — это надежный, энергоэффективный и более совершенный наследник процессора 6502. Его прямой современный аналог — W65C02S от Western Design Center, который до сих пор находится в производстве и активно используется в ретро-проектах и новых разработках.